- Roommate of accused Charlie Kirk shooter says Tyler Robinson admitted to slaying
Tyler Robinson allegedly admitted to his roommate Lance Twiggs that he killed conservative commentator Charlie Kirk during an outdoor rally. Evidence including bullet casings and DNA from a towel found at the scene link Robinson to the crime. Robinson turned himself in after the shooting and faces the death penalty if convicted.

- A timeline of Charlie Kirk's assassination and the arrest of Tyler Robinson
Tyler Robinson, a 23-year-old man, is accused of assassinating Charlie Kirk during an event at Utah Valley University. A preliminary hearing will determine if the case proceeds to trial, with the death penalty a potential punishment. Kirk, a conservative podcaster and co-founder of Turning Point USA, was shot during a Q&A session, and social media videos captured the incident.
